Charming and fragrant - paprika, red flowers, forest berries, and a touch of mushroom. The nose pulls you in gently, then the structure tightens: high acidity, firm yet polished tannin. Still young, clearly, but already seamless and well-balanced. A wine that feels effortless to drink, though it lacks the gravitas and layered depth of the 2011. Still, a beautiful showing.
One bottle was more oxidized. This bottle was clearly off. Vegetal and oxidised, veering toward Madeira territory. On the palate it's slightly sweet but redeemed somewhat by decent acidity. The tannin, however, is overly dry and the whole thing feels dusty and tired. Just not in a good place - if it ever was.
